Ranking of North Carolina Counties By Percentage of Population that are Non-Hispanic Two Or More Races in 2023

Updated on June 18, 2025.

Based on the US Census Vintage data estimates, in 2023, among all North Carolina counties, Swain County had the highest percentage of its population who identified their ethnicity as Non-Hispanic Two Or More Races (4.59%), followed by Cumberland County (4.39%), and Hoke County (4.24%).
